Abstract
It's obvious in modern conditions that the process of globalization has already got a digital character. For this reason it can be called digital globalization. Digital globalization is a new step of the global world development. It entails radical changes in the structure of making business and the number of its permanent participants. It leads to the growth of economic opportunities, including trans-border relations and communications. Digital transformations are based on the growing consumer and investor expectations. They also reflect the prospect of increasing economic and social benefits. Digital globalization depends on both digital economy and digital technology development. Technological prerequisites for the digital globalization are the achievements of the fourth industrial revolution, such as robotics and the Internet of things, cloud and cognitive technologies, virtual and augmented realities, nano-and biotechnology, etc. Digital globalization is closely connected to a number of economic innovations. Today financial flows, traditional ways of trading and changing goods are reduced much at the global level due to the COVID-19 pandemic. On the contrast, the global economic relations of the digital format are significantly expanding. This becomes possible because of the artificial intelligence technology development, the global data and information flows attraction, the digital platforms and e-commerce successful using.
